Green Bean Salad with Salmon
The green bean salad with salmon from Spoonsparrow delivers healthy nutrients and tastes really good!
Ingredients
- 600 g green beans
- Salt
- 1 red bell pepper
- 0.5 bunch Chives
- 3 tbsp Sesame oil
- 200 g bamboo shoots (canned, sliced)
- 100 g bean sprouts (or soy sprouts)
- 400 g Salmon fillet
- 3 tbsp Soy sauce
- Pepper
- 1 tbsp coriander seeds
Instructions
-
1.
Wash beans and blanch for about 6–8 minutes in boiling salted water. Wash pepper, halve it, remove seeds and slice into strips. Wash chives, shake dry and cut in half.
-
2.
Sauté pepper and beans in 2 tbsp sesame oil. Drain sprouts and rinse seedlings. Add both to the pan and simmer over low heat for about 3–4 minutes while stirring. Finally fold in chives, add 2 tbsp soy sauce, remove from heat and let rest.
-
3.
Wash salmon and pat dry. Drizzle with 1 tbsp oil and grill each side slowly for about 5 minutes (longer or shorter depending on thickness). Brush with 1 tbsp soy sauce, season with pepper, remove from grill. Crush coriander seeds in a mortar and sprinkle over the salmon. Cut salmon into small pieces.
-
4.
Arrange the green bean salad with salmon on plates and serve.
